Alan Hutton wants Aston Villa to sign a new striker in the January transfer window in case anything happens to Ollie Watkins.

The 27-year-old striker has been in superb form this season. However, he's having to start in both the Premier League and the Europa Conference League due to Jhon Duran's recent injury issues.

Duran, 19, is a highly-rated talent but he's also not played many games from the start for the Villans so it's unclear whether or not he's at the level to spearhead the attack every week.

Hutton admits that Duran hasn't had the chance to do that yet but if anything was to happen to Watkins, Unai Emery needs a more reliable option to replace the England international up front.

"Ollie Watkins is taking a lot of the load and a lot of the pressure up there," Hutton told Villa News.

"I know there are a lot of people who can contribute around him but if anything was to happen to him like an injury or a loss of form - touch wood it doesn't - Duran will be there.

"He provides competition but he's still very young and he's still very raw.

"Is he capable of playing in the Premier League every week? I'm not so sure yet but then again, he's not had that run of games for us to see.

"It would be good if Villa were to target another striker to come in and lighten that load for them."
